Pickering Castle, c14th century, (c1990-2010). Motte and bailey (stone castle). Reconstruction drawing. Originally a timber and earth motte and bailey castle built by the Normans under William the Conqueror in 1069-1070. It was developed into a stone motte and bailey castle, from 1323 and 1326 with an outer ward and curtain wall built along with three towers.
